What happened

MCHP fell 2.9% to $71.35

Microchip Technology (MCHP) declined 2.78% to $71.41 amid a sector-wide semiconductor pullback and macroeconomic headwinds, according to web search synthesis. Broad profit-taking in tech stocks and rising Treasury yields are pressuring the group rather than company-specific negative catalysts; the business itself posted strong fiscal Q1 earnings and upbeat guidance in August. Volume of 3.07M shares (1.14x normal for this time of session) reflects orderly profit-taking. Earnings scheduled for 2026-11-05 (consensus EPS $0.79); monitor whether the company reaffirms guidance and revenue trajectory in light of profitability concerns cited by analysts.
